You can view additional details and a detailed write up for this project here: In this project I use Vagrant and VirtualBox on Windows to create three Ubuntu Linux servers to explore ansible. I then use an Ansible playbook to install a Multi-server LEMP stack with an external and internal network. To run this, first prepare your system to use Vagrant based on these instructions: Clone this repository and from a command line run. That will take several minutes but it will result in three new servers running in VirtualBox on your system. You will then want to login to the control box over SSH (watch the vagrant output to know on which port SSH is running). Then cd into the lemp directory inside the vagrant shared directory and run the ansible playbook. Depending on your environment, you may need to uncomment the proxy declarations and identify your proxy environment in the files. You should be able to view the wall web page.

            PHP requires the Visual C runtime (CRT). The Microsoft Visual C++ Redistributable for Visual Studio 2019 is suitable for all these PHP versions, see visualstudio.microsoft.com. You MUST download the x86 CRT for PHP x86 builds and the x64 CRT for PHP x64 builds. The CRT installer supports the /quiet and /norestart command-line switches, so you can also script it.
